{"data":{"id":"us-id/idaho-code-42-1764","jurisdiction":"us-id","citation":"Idaho Code § 42-1764","heading":"Substitution for transfer proceeding — Rights not subject to forfeiture — No dedication of rights.","body":"(1) The approval of a rental of water from the water supply bank may be a substitute for the transfer proceeding requirements of section 42-222, Idaho Code.\n(2) Water rights obtained by the board or by a local committee appointed by the board and credited to the water supply bank are not subject to forfeiture for nonuse pursuant to section 42-222(2), Idaho Code, while retained in or rented from the water supply bank. The five (5) year period of nonuse for forfeiture of a water right shall begin to run anew upon removal of a right from the bank.\n(3) The rental of water rights from the water supply bank shall not constitute a dedication to the lands of any renter since the rental or distribution of water by the water bank is only incidental to its primary purposes listed in section 42-1761, Idaho Code.","path":["TITLE 42 IRRIGATION AND DRAINAGE — WATER RIGHTS AND RECLAMATION","CHAPTER 17 DEPARTMENT OF WATER RESOURCES — WATER RESOURCE BOARD"],"source_url":"https://legislature.idaho.gov/statutesrules/idstat/title42/t42ch17/sect42-1764/","current_through":"2026 Legislative Session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-04T11:21:14Z","sha256":"3254ba9106aa07c07232ff4a952d0aae87e8f1f4cedcb45562199ce1a4f94e7c","source_id":"us-id","stale":false,"prev":"us-id/idaho-code-42-1763b","next":"us-id/idaho-code-42-1765"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
